Daniil Medvedev is 4 wins away to conquer the title in St. Petersburg. The Russian has defeated Richard Gasquet 3-6 6-3 6-0 to reach the 2nd round where he will face Reilly Opelka.

Draw Prediction with head to head records

This is Daniil Medvedev’s projected draw alongside with the likely opposition at the St. Petersburg Open. The Russian has a favorable record (10-5) with the plausible opponents.

R1 – Richard Gasquet (53) – 3-6 6-3 6-0
R2 – Reilly Opelka (36) – H2H 2-0
1/4 – Borna Coric (27) – H2H 2-4
or Roman Safiullin (199) – H2H 0-0
1/2 – Karen Khachanov (17) – H2H 2-1
or Milos Raonic (21) – H2H 2-0
Fin – Andrey Rublev (10) – H2H 4-0
or Denis Shapovalov (12) – H2H 1-2

R2 – Reilly Opelka’s rankings and performance.

Head to head 2-0 for Daniil Medvedev

Reilly Opelka Point Table info

Reilly Opelka has a 11-6 win-loss record in 2020, 3-1 on indoor hard courts. As for the previous 5 years, Reilly has a 34-13 record on indoor hard courts (Click here to see full career record). Opelka won 7 of his last 10 matches.

His best achievement of the year was managing to win the tournament in Delray Beach where he overcame Yoshihito Nishioka in the final 7-5 6-7(4) 6-2.

Last year in St. Petersburg Open the American didn’t compete in this tournament.

H2H Daniil Medvedev vs. Reilly Opelka

This contest would be 3rd time that Daniil Medvedev and Reilly Opelka square off. The head to head is 2-0 for Medvedev (see full H2H stats), but they have never competed against each other on indoor hard courts .

1/4 – Borna Coric’s rankings and performance.

Head to head 4-2 for Borna Coric

Borna Coric Point Table info

Borna Coric has a 11-9 win-loss record in 2020, 1-0 on indoor hard courts. In the last 5 years, the Croatian has a 38-34 record on indoor hard courts (Click here to see full career record). The Croatian won 6 of his last 10 matches.

Borna’s best achievement of the season was reaching the semi-finals in Rio de Janeiro.

Last year in St. Petersburg Open Borna lost to Daniil Medvedev in the final 6-3 6-1.

H2H Daniil Medvedev vs. Borna Coric

This would be the 7th time that Daniil Medvedev and Borna Coric play each other. The head to head is 4-2 for Coric (see full H2H stats), 2-1 on indoor hard courts .

However, Daniil Medvedev could come up against Roman Safiullin. Their H2H is 0-0.

1/2 – Karen Khachanov’s rankings and performance.

Head to head 2-1 for Daniil Medvedev

Karen Khachanov Point Table info

Karen Khachanov has a 18-11 record in 2020, 2-2 on indoor hard courts. In the last 5 years, Karen has a 89-58 record on indoor hard courts (Click here to see full career record). Khachanov won 6 of his last 10 matches.

Last year in St. Petersburg Open Karen surrendered to Joao Sousa in the 2nd round 7-6(2) 6-4.

H2H Daniil Medvedev vs. Karen Khachanov

This match would represent the 4th time that Daniil Medvedev and Karen Khachanov fight against each other. The head to head is 2-1 for Medvedev (see full H2H stats), but they are 1-1 on indoor hard courts .

Possibly, Daniil Medvedev could fight against Milos Raonic. Their head to head record is 2-0 for Daniil Medvedev.

Final – Andrey Rublev’s rankings and performance.

Head to head 4-0 for Daniil Medvedev

Andrey Rublev Point Table info

Andrey Rublev has a 30-7 record in 2020, 3-1 on indoor hard courts. As for the previous 5 years, Andrey has a 79-48 record on indoor hard courts (Click here to see full career record). Andrey won 9 of his last 10 matches.

His best result of the season was winning the tournament in Doha where he overcame Corentin Moutet in the final 6-2 7-6(3), in Adelaide where he defeated Lloyd Harris in the final 6-3 6-0, and in Hamburg where he beat Stefanos Tsitsipas in the final 6-4 3-6 7-5.

Last year in St. Petersburg Open the Russian was overcome by Daniil Medvedev in the quarter 6-4 7-5.

H2H Daniil Medvedev vs. Andrey Rublev

This match would represent the 5th time that Daniil Medvedev and Andrey Rublev square off. The head to head is 4-0 for Medvedev (see full H2H stats), 2-0 on indoor hard courts .

Anyhow, Daniil Medvedev could face Denis Shapovalov. Their head to head record is 2-1 for Denis Shapovalov.
